Dance Movement Studies Schools in West Virginia
10 Dance Movement Studies students earned their degrees in the state in 2022-2023.
A Dance Movement Studies major is the 347th most popular major in this state.

Jobs for Dance Movement Studies Grads in West Virginia
660 people in the state and 109,120 in the nation are employed in jobs related to dance movement studies.

Wages for Dance Movement Studies Jobs in West Virginia
Dance Movement Studies grads earn an average of $52,560 in the state and $53,560 nationwide.
